The Committee on the Environment (COTE®) is an AIA Knowledge Community working for architects, allied professionals, and the public to achieve climate action and climate justice through design. We believe that design excellence is the foundation of a healthy, sustainable, and equitable future. Our work promotes design strategies that empower all AIA members to realize the best social and environmental outcomes with the clients and the communities they serve.

    Architect and affordable housing expert Katie Swenson is a fierce advocate for love as a design force that helps communities lift everyone. She is also the latest guest on the #DesigntheFuture podcast for Acuity Brands' #WomeninSustainability platform. Katie joined MASS Design Group early this year. She told me and Lindsay Baker that she has always thought of herself as a "community architect." 


    While Katie was a Loeb Fellow at Harvard GSD, she asked: "What role do love and kindness play in urban design?" Love is also at the core of Katie's two new books (Schiffer Publishing, 2020). In Bohemia: A Memoir of Love, Loss, and Kindness, which Katie wrote following the death of her partner, is also about architecture, history, and home. Design with Love: At Home in America, chronicles the work of the Enterprise Community Partners Rose Fellowship, uplifting these collaborations.
